Unbreathing Horde trades in getting bigger when more zombies are around (moving or not) for being vastly harder to put down, and the horrible in ability to die to damage so long as something else toughens them, tack on its ability to neutralize trample, and the only reason I don't run 4 of them is that I like playing with my friends, rather then driving them away.
Combined with Endless Ranks of the Dead and any kind of recursion (I prefer Lord of the Undead myself) you can happily sacrifice it to something, ( Corpse Harvester is about to be one very busy Zombie Wizard!) and then bring it out again even stronger.
It is cards like this which truely justify white's powerful exile and destroy cards. Path to Exile and Day of Judgement (or the old school Wrath of God ) pretty much exist to deal with things like these. Arrest is also good, and even a Unsummon can be worthwhile.

This is a big stop sign for many a kitchen top aggro deck. So what if your Diregraf Ghoul or Highborn Ghoul traded for one of their guys? Just drop the horde T3 as a 2/2 or 3/3, or if your life's not in too much danger then T4 after Diregraf Captain.
Mitigates trample and deathtouch, and when he's finally out of lives or when the captain is killed just bring them both back to life with Ghoulcaller's Chant. Really deters ground-based aggro and leaves removal for the fliers.
